본 고안은 자동차용 리어컴비네이션 램프의 벤트구조에 관한 것으로 더욱 상세하게는 자동차 등화장치의 하나로 후방에서 진행하는 자동차에 의사전달과 각종 정보 제공을 위해 미등, 브레이크등, 후진등 및 방향지시등으로 조합된 자동차용 리어컴비네이션 램프(rear combination lamp)에 있어서;The present invention relates to a vent structure of a rear combination lamp for a vehicle. More specifically, it is a combination of a tail light, a brake light, a reversing light, and a direction light for communicating and providing various kinds of information to a car running behind a car as one of the automobile lighting devices. In a rear combination lamp for an automobile;

상기 램프의 발광시 생성되는 다량의 열을 방출하고 공기의 순환에 의해 습기등을 제거하는 벤트구조 개선에 관한 것이다.The present invention relates to a vent structure improvement that emits a large amount of heat generated when the lamp emits light and removes moisture by circulation of air.

일반적으로 자동차는 주행중 각종 신호의 수단으로 등화장치를 구비하며, 상기 등화장치중 도 1에서와 같이 자동차 후미 양측 가장자리에 장착되는 리어 컴비네이션 램프(1)는 후방에서 뒤따르는 상대차량에게 자신의 차량상태를 알리기 위한 수단으로 사용된다.In general, a vehicle includes an equalizer as a means of various signals while driving, and the rear combination lamp 1 mounted at both edges of the rear end of the equalizer among the equalizers has its own vehicle status to the relative vehicle following the rear. It is used as a means to inform.

상기 리어컴비네이션 램프(1)는 크게 방수형과 비방수형으로 구분되나, 현재 국내에서 생산되는 승용차의 경우 모두 방수형으로 제조된다.The rear combination lamp 1 is largely divided into a waterproof type and a non-waterproof type, but in the case of passenger cars produced in Korea, all are manufactured in a waterproof type.

상기 방수형 리어컴비네이션 램프(1)는 도 2 및 도 3에서와 같이 외부와 밀폐된 하우징(10)을 구비하고, 그 내방으로 각 시스템과 연계된 전구(11)가 장착된다.The waterproof rear combination lamp 1 has a housing 10 sealed to the outside as shown in Figs. 2 and 3, and is fitted with a light bulb 11 associated with each system.

상기 리어컴비네이션 램프는 구성조건으로 인해 점등시 내, 외부의 압력차이로 인해 램프(1)의 렌즈(12)주위에 습기와 다량의 열이 발생된다.The rear combination lamp generates moisture and a large amount of heat around the lens 12 of the lamp 1 due to internal and external pressure differences when the lamp is turned on due to a construction condition.

상기 램프 렌즈(12)의 표면에 습기가 발생할 경우 조도가 급격히 저하하여 외부에서의 식별력이 급격히 떨어져 신호수단으로서의 제기능을 적절히 수행하지 못하게 되고,When moisture is generated on the surface of the lamp lens 12, the illuminance is sharply lowered and the discriminating power from the outside is sharply dropped, thereby preventing proper function as a signal means.

전구(11)에서 생성된 과다한 열은 전구(11)의 파손을 초래하여 내구성저하와 부품교체로 인한 유지 및 보수비용이 증가되는 문제점을 안고 있었다.Excessive heat generated from the light bulb 11 causes the light bulb 11 to be damaged, resulting in a decrease in durability and increased maintenance and repair costs due to component replacement.

그리하여 도 3 및 도 4에서와 같이 리어컴비네이션 램프 하우징(10) 저면에 다수 개의 벤트홀(13)을 구비하여 하우징(10)내방의 공기순환을 원활히하여 습기방지와 열방출을 도모하도록 하였다.Thus, as shown in FIGS. 3 and 4, a plurality of vent holes 13 are provided on the bottom of the rear combination lamp housing 10 to facilitate air circulation in the housing 10 to prevent moisture and release heat.

상기 벤트홀(13)은 도 4에서와 같이 선단에 단턱(14)을 형성한 원통형으로 단턱(14)부위에는 고무재등의 벤트튜브(15)가 개재되고, 벤트홀(13)의 외방에는 수분유입을 방지하는 벤트댐(16)이 형성된다.The vent hole 13 has a cylindrical shape in which the stepped portion 14 is formed at the tip as shown in FIG. 4, and a vent tube 15 made of rubber or the like is interposed in the stepped portion 14, A vent dam 16 is formed to prevent water inflow.

상기 벤트홀(13)의 선단에 개재되는 벤트튜브(15)는 개략 '⊃'형으로 개방상태의 벤트홀(13)을 통하여 램프하우징(10)내방으로 수분 및 이물질유입을 방지하는 역할을 수행한다.The vent tube 15 interposed at the tip of the vent hole 13 serves to prevent inflow of moisture and foreign matter into the lamp housing 10 through the vent hole 13 in an open state in a roughly '형' shape. do.

상기와 같은 벤트홀(13)은 자동차의 주행중 발생하는 리어컴비네이션 램프(1)의 점등으로 인한 발열과 습기생성을 공기의 유동에 의해 억제하여전구(11)의 내구성증대와 신호수단으로서의 역할수행을 원활히 할 수 있도록 하는 장점을 가진다.The vent hole 13 as described above suppresses heat generation and moisture generation due to the lighting of the rear combination lamp 1 generated while driving a vehicle by the flow of air, thereby increasing durability of the bulb 11 and performing a role as a signaling means. It has the advantage of making it smooth.

하지만, 상기 벤트홀(13)은 그 생성과정에서 작업공정수가 복잡하고 구성부품수가 과다하여 생산단가를 상승시키는 원인으로 작용함은 물론 조립공정이 증가하여 생산성저하를 초래하였다.However, the vent hole 13 is a cause of increasing the production cost due to the complexity of the number of work processes and excessive number of components in the production process, as well as increase the assembly process, resulting in a decrease in productivity.

또한 상기 벤트홀(13)의 선단에 개재된 벤트튜브(15)의 형상이 절곡체로 인해 공기마찰에 의한 유동성이 저하되어 원활한 방열과 습기제거가 이루어지지 않는 단점도 안고 있었다.In addition, the shape of the vent tube 15 interposed at the front end of the vent hole 13 has a disadvantage in that fluidity due to air friction is lowered due to the bent body, thereby preventing smooth heat dissipation and moisture removal.

이에 본 고안은 상기한 문제점들을 해결하기 위해 안출된 것으로 전구소켓과 하우징상간의 공간을 이용한 벤트홀의 생성으로 별도의 벤트홀과 벤트튜브를 삭제하여 부품수와 가공공정을 간소화하고, 벤트홀의 형상을 직관화하여 원활한 공기유동에 의한 방열 및 습기제거능력을 상승시킴을 그 목적으로 한다.Therefore, the present invention was devised to solve the above problems, and by creating a vent hole using a space between the light bulb socket and the housing, the separate vent hole and the vent tube were deleted to simplify the number of parts and the machining process, and to reduce the shape of the vent hole. Its purpose is to increase heat dissipation and moisture removal ability by smooth air flow.

이하 첨부되는 도면과 관련하여 본 고안의 구성 및 작용에 대하여 설명하면 다음과 같다.Hereinafter, the configuration and operation of the present invention will be described with reference to the accompanying drawings.

도 5는 본 고안이 적용된 자동차용 리어컴비네이션 램프를 도시한 배면도, 도 6은 본 고안의 요부인 자동차용 리어컴비네이션 램프의 벤트구조를 도시한 단면도, 도 7은 본 고안인 자동차용 리어컴비네이션 램프의 벤트구조를 도시한 일부 확대 단면도로서 함께 설명한다.5 is a rear view showing a rear combination lamp for a vehicle to which the present invention is applied, and FIG. It will be described together with some enlarged cross-sectional view showing the vent structure of.

상기 목적을 달성하기 위한 본 고안인 자동차용 리어컴비네이션 램프(2)는 도 5에서와 같이 그 형상이 타원을 이루는 유선형의 하우징(20)과,Automotive rear combination lamp 2 of the present invention for achieving the above object is a streamlined housing 20, the shape of which is an ellipse as shown in FIG.

상기 하우징(20) 배면에는 각종 전구(21)를 체결하기위한 체결공(22)이 다수 개 형성된다.A plurality of fastening holes 22 for fastening various light bulbs 21 are formed on the rear surface of the housing 20.

상기 체결공(22)은 도 6에서와 같이 선단부에 단턱(23)과 돌기(24)를 구비하고, 그 외방 일측으로는 다양한 형상을 가지는 벤트댐(25)이 하우징(20)과 일체로 형성된다.As shown in FIG. 6, the fastening hole 22 includes a step 23 and a protrusion 24 at a tip end thereof, and a vent dam 25 having various shapes is formed integrally with the housing 20 at one side thereof. do.

상기와 같이 구성된 체결공(22)에는 원통형으로 일측에 전원 인가에 요구되는 커넥터(26)가 구비되고, 타측에는 전구(21)를 수용하는 요입홈(27)을 형성하여 체결공(22)의 단턱(23)과 돌기(24)에 상응하는 다수의 단(段;28)을 형성한 전구소켓(29)이 체결된다.The fastening hole 22 configured as described above is provided with a connector 26 required to apply power to one side in a cylindrical shape, and the other side of the fastening hole 22 is formed by forming a recessed groove 27 for accommodating the light bulb 21. The bulb socket 29 is formed by forming a plurality of stages 28 corresponding to the step 23 and the protrusion 24.

상기 전구소켓(29)이 고정된 체결공(22)의 조립부위(p)에는 단턱(23)과 돌기(24)를 도 6 및 도 7에서와 같이 그 형상을 축소하거나 삭제하여 다른 형상이 되도록 구비하여 체결공(22)과 전구 소켓(29)상간에 벤트홀(30)이 형성되도록 한다.In the assembly portion (p) of the fastening hole 22 to which the bulb socket 29 is fixed, the step 23 and the protrusion 24 are reduced or deleted as shown in FIGS. 6 and 7 so as to have a different shape. It is provided so that the vent hole 30 is formed between the fastening hole 22 and the bulb socket 29.

상기 체결공(22)에 형성된 벤트홀(30)은 하우징(20)의 규격에 대응하여 원주면에 대하여 등간격으로 다수 개 구비하여 원활한 공기유동이 이루어질 수 있도록 구성한다.The vent holes 30 formed in the fastening holes 22 are provided in a plurality at equal intervals with respect to the circumferential surface corresponding to the standard of the housing 20 so as to enable smooth air flow.

상기와 같은 본 고안의 작용상태를 종래 구성의 문제점과 비교하여 설명하면 다음과 같다.Referring to the operational state of the present invention as described above compared with the problems of the conventional configuration as follows.

자동차용 리어 컴비네이션 램프(2)는 주행중 발생하는 도로의 각종 상황을알리는 신호수단으로 램프 하우징(20)의 체결공(22)에 장착된 전구(21)가 발광하고, 발산된 빛을 하우징(20)의 전면에 구비된 렌즈(31)를 통하여 외부로 표출하므로 가능하다.The rear combination lamp 2 for a vehicle is a signal means for notifying various situations of a road occurring while driving, and the light bulb 21 mounted at the fastening hole 22 of the lamp housing 20 emits light and emits light emitted from the housing 20. It is possible because it is expressed to the outside through the lens 31 provided on the front of the).

상기 램프 하우징(20)은 밀폐식의 방수형 구조로 전구(21)의 지속적인 발광으로 인해 온도가 상승하고,The lamp housing 20 is a sealed waterproof structure, the temperature rises due to the continuous light emission of the light bulb 21,

상승된 온도로 인해 하우징의 내, 외부 압력에 편차가 발생하여 렌즈(31)부위에 습기가 발생하며 전구(21)주위에는 다대한 열이 생성된다.Due to the elevated temperature, the internal and external pressure of the housing may be varied, thereby generating moisture in the lens 31 and generating a large amount of heat around the bulb 21.

이러한 하우징(20)내방의 습기와 열을 외부로 방출시키기 위해 체결공(22)과 전구 소켓(29)의 조립부위(p)에 벤트홀(30)을 형성하여 외부공기유입에 의한 방습과 방열을 동시에 이룬다.In order to discharge moisture and heat inside the housing 20 to the outside, a vent hole 30 is formed at an assembly portion p of the fastening hole 22 and the bulb socket 29 to prevent moisture and heat dissipation by inflow of external air. At the same time.

또한 본 고안의 벤트홀(30)은 종래에서와 같은 별도의 벤트튜브의 개재를 삭제하는데,In addition, the vent hole 30 of the present invention deletes the inclusion of a separate vent tube as in the prior art.

이는 체결공(22) 외방에 형성된 벤트댐(25)에 의해 벤트튜브의 역할인 수분유입을 방지함으로 인해 가능하다.This is possible by preventing the inflow of water which is a role of the vent tube by the vent dam 25 formed outside the fastening hole 22.

상기와 같이 본 고안이 적용된 리어 컴비네이션 램프(2)는 하우징(20)과 벤트홀(22)을 일체로 구비하여 별도의 제작공정을 삭제하여 가공 및 조립공정을 간소화할 수 있다.The rear combination lamp 2 to which the present invention is applied as described above may be provided with the housing 20 and the vent hole 22 integrally, thereby eliminating a separate manufacturing process, thereby simplifying the processing and assembly process.

이처럼 가공 및 조립의 간소화는 종래 램프 하우징에 구비된 벤트홀과 벤트튜브로 인하여 초래된 문제점인 다대한 제작공정과 조립공정으로 인한 생산단가 상승과 생산량 저하를 해결할 수 있다.As such, the simplification of processing and assembly can solve the production cost increase and the yield decrease due to the numerous manufacturing and assembly processes, which are problems caused by the vent holes and the vent tubes provided in the conventional lamp housing.

이상과 같은 본 고안인 자동차용 리어컴비네이션 램프의 벤트구조는 구조를간소화하여 가공 및 조립공정을 축소할 수 있어 생산성 향상과 원가절감을 동시에 이룰 수 있음은 물론 벤트홀의 증가로 인한 하우징내방의 원활한 공기유동을 초래하여 전구의 내구성증대와 시인성 향상을 이룰 수 있는 유용한 고안이다.The vent structure of the car rear combination lamp of the present invention as described above can simplify the structure and reduce the processing and assembly processes, resulting in improved productivity and cost reduction, as well as smooth air in the housing due to the increase of vent holes. It is a useful design that can increase the durability and visibility of the bulb by causing flow.
